certify
Runs TPM2_Certify
|
-ho object handle |
[-pwdo password for object (default empty)] -hk certifying key handle [-pwdk password for key (default empty)] [-halg (sha1, sha256, sha384) (default sha256)] [-salg signature algorithm (rsa, ecc) (default rsa)] [-qd qualifying data file name] [-os signature file name (default do not save)] [-oa attestation output file name (default do not save)]
|
-se[0-2] session handle / attributes (default PWAP) |
01 continue
